Running a node is an important way to contribute to the network. Like a wallet, running a node lets you send and receive $IRON. Your node will likewise help validate other peoples transactions to be sure they’re obeying the rules that govern all transactions. The more folks which are watching to ensure transactions are following the rules, the more secure the network.
